Loretta Mester on Economic Uncertainty, Fed's Readiness, and Inflation Risks
CNBC TelevisionApril 7, 20254 min2,845 views
5 connections·8 entities in this video→Fed's Position on Economic Uncertainty
- 💡 Loretta Mester believes the Federal Reserve is well-placed to respond to economic uncertainty, whether growth slows more than expected or inflation persists.
- 🎯 The Fed's monetary policy is considered adaptable to various economic scenarios.
Consumer Spending and Economic Stability
- ⚠️ Concerns exist regarding the stability of consumer spending, with the top 10% of earners accounting for a significant portion of consumption.
- 📉 While wealthier individuals typically spend more, lower and median-income individuals drive spending volatility and growth, making their situation a key concern.
Impact of Tariffs and Business Sentiment
- 📈 Tariffs are a source of economic uncertainty that could reduce spending and hiring, potentially leading to a slowdown.
- 🗣️ Businesses are adopting a wait-and-see attitude, mirroring past reactions to tariff implementations which previously led to economic slowdowns.
Inflationary Risks and Fed Strategy
- ⚠️ The current economic starting point, with already high inflation, suggests tariffs could be more inflationary this time.
- 📈 Rising inflation expectations pose a risk to achieving the 2% inflation target in the near term.
- ⏸️ Mester suspects the Fed's strategy might be to remain at current rates until there is material evidence of economic weakening, with potential rate cuts later in the year.
Federal Workers and Economic Disruption
- 💼 The potential disruption to federal workers and contractors due to events like the Doge chaos is a factor to consider, though the Fed's positioning is about its ability to react to economic outcomes.
